- Follow Procedures: Ensure Siemens Energy procedures for Inspection and Test Plans (ITP) and Inspection and Finding reports (IFR) are adhered to, and all relevant protocols and forms are completed and signed.
- Technical Support: Provide on-site technical support for Project Manager, Site Superintendent, and Site Supervisors, ensuring quality documentation is correctly completed and data is transferred to the master digital record.
- Customer Collaboration: Work with Siemens Energy technical leads and supervisors to make recommendations to the customer regarding findings or non-conformances, and secure agreement on actions to be taken.
- Corrective Actions: Raise IFRs for any findings, ensure customer acknowledgment before rectification, and confirm corrective actions have ITPs and meet required standards.
- Supervision and Documentation: Supervise off-site work, ensure all Change Orders and Variations have ITPs, and confirm all ITPs and record sheets are signed off before commissioning works.
- Continuous Improvement: Assist in preparing and implementing the project Quality Plan, ensuring all contractual and OEM requirements are met, and contribute to the continuous improvement of site processes and digitalization initiatives.
